Colorado Payroll Employment By County for The Private Construction Industry in May, 2023
Updated on January 7, 2024.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in May, 2023, Colorado added 2,665 number of jobs to the private construction industry. Among Colorado counties, Adams added the highest number of jobs (576), followed by Weld (295), and Jefferson (234).
